  • Expenses that qualify under IRS guidance for non-taxable reimbursed business expenses are referred to as a “Reimbursement”. Reimbursements can be paid out of the MTD account for which you are responsible or from ministry project funds. Reimbursements will be paid in the order in which they are received. Although Reliant may normally pay certain expense reimbursements in such a way that they are not included in the employee's federal taxable income, the employee bears ultimate responsibility for the proper tax treatment of all payments received from Reliant, and should consult with his or her tax adviser to determine the appropriate reporting and treatment of such payments.
  • Requests for recovery of expenses that do not qualify for non-taxable reimbursement under the IRS guidance are referred to as “Expense Recovery Bonus or ERB. These expenses will be recuperated through a bonus which will be considered additional taxable wages (compensation) for the field staff. Due to the fact that only paid employees can receive a taxable bonus, associates and project funds are not eligible to submit a request for an Expense Recovery Bonus.
  • You may request advance payment for anticipated, reimbursable expenses through an "Expense Advance". Advances are not guaranteed, but will be considered on a case-by-case basis.
  • Expense submissions related to a ministry project fund also have the option of requesting payment through a "Grant" rather than a Reimbursement. Grants are also used for the expense of an item that the ministry project will retain ownership of beyond its initial use. (See Grant ProcessReimbursements vs. Grants for more details)

Key Change to the Standard: Expense Recovery Bonus (ERB) is the new term for what was formerly known as a taxable reimbursement. These bonuses are now being routed through compensation rather than through the reimbursements queue. An unpaid bonus due to insufficient funds is now short-checked and held in the backpay queue.
